Advantages Of Postgresql Over Mssql

People are currently reading this guide.

The Great Database Showdown: PostgreSQL vs. MSSQL - Why Postgres Wins (and Makes MSSQL Cry)

Let's face it, choosing a database is a big decision. It's like picking a roommate in college: you gotta find someone reliable, with enough space for your stuff, and who preferably doesn't blast Nickelback at 3 AM (looking at you, Steve from accounting).

In the world of databases, there are two big players: Microsoft SQL Server (MSSQL) and PostgreSQL. Today, we're putting them head-to-head to see who comes out on top.

Round 1: Cost - Free Isn't Just for Samples at Costco (But It Should Be)

MSSQL: Like that fancy gym membership you never use, MSSQL comes with a hefty price tag. You gotta pay for the software, licensing, and then there's the whole "hiring a Microsoft consultant to decipher error messages" expense.

PostgreSQL: Open source, baby! That means you can download it, use it, and tinker with it to your heart's content, all without needing a small loan. It's the perfect choice for the budget-conscious developer, or let's be honest, anyone who'd rather spend their money on, you know, actual fun things.

Round 2: Features - More Bells and Whistles Than a Clown Convention

MSSQL: MSSQL offers a solid set of features, but it's kind of like that all-inclusive resort with only three restaurants. Sure, you'll get what you need, but it might feel a bit limited.

PostgreSQL: PostgreSQL boasts a vast array of features, including built-in JSON support (perfect for all your modern web app needs), advanced data types, and functions that would make even Excel jealous. It's like a five-star database with a Michelin-starred chef in the back - it has everything and it's all amazing.

Round 3: Flexibility - Bend and Don't Break (Unlike That Time You Tried Yoga)

MSSQL: MSSQL is a bit rigid, like a suit that's two sizes too small. It works best in a Microsoft environment and can be less forgiving of customization.

PostgreSQL: PostgreSQL is the ultimate contortionist. It runs on pretty much any operating system you can throw at it, and it can be easily extended with custom functions and modules. Need a specific feature? Just whip up a quick extension and PostgreSQL will do your bidding.

Round 4: Community - Friends Don't Let Friends Use Outdated Software

MSSQL: The MSSQL community is decent, but it can feel a bit corporate. It's like those neighborhood gatherings where everyone just talks about their kids' soccer trophies.

PostgreSQL: The PostgreSQL community is vibrant, active, and hilarious. They're always there to help you troubleshoot a query or just have a good laugh about your latest database mishap. It's like hanging out with your favorite techie friends - there's always something new to learn and a good meme to share.

Decision Time: PostgreSQL FTW!

So, there you have it. PostgreSQL takes the crown as the champion database. It's free, feature-rich, flexible, and has a fantastic community. Unless you're deeply entrenched in the Microsoft ecosystem or secretly enjoy paying for software (weird flex, but okay), PostgreSQL is the clear winner.

Now, go forth and build amazing things with your newfound database knowledge! Just remember, with great power comes great responsibility...and the occasional SQL injection attack. But hey, that's what the PostgreSQL community is for, right?

6244240505130300093

hows.tech

You have our undying gratitude for your visit!